Overbite in Arlington MA: Causes, Consequences and Treatment Strategies

An overbite is a common dental issue in which the upper front teeth significantly overlap the lower front teeth. Though a minor overlap is normal, an excessive overbite can cause multiple oral health problems if ignored. Defining Overbite vs Overjet: Common Dental Misalignments

It is important to know the difference between an overbite and an overjet. An overbite refers to when the upper teeth vertically overlap the lower teeth. Meanwhile, an overjet describes the horizontal projection of the upper teeth beyond the lower teeth. Understanding these distinctions helps identify the proper treatment.

Causes of Severe Overjet and Overbite

Severe overjet and overbite can arise from various factors, including:

Skeletal irregularities in the jaw structure
Misaligned teeth
Genetic predisposition
Childhood habits like thumb-sucking or prolonged pacifier use

Understanding the underlying causes is essential for developing an effective treatment plan tailored to your specific needs.

Signs and Symptoms of an Overbite

Early detection of an overbite is crucial for preventing further complications and ensuring successful treatment outcomes. Some key indicators to watch out for include:

Upper teeth significantly overlapping the lower teeth
Excessive visibility of the upper teeth compared to the lower teeth
Difficulty in closing the mouth properly
Potential facial imbalance or jaw discomfort

If you notice any of these signs, it’s advisable to seek professional evaluation from an orthodontist.

Potential Health Issues from Untreated Overbite

Failing to address an overbite can lead to significant oral health and overall well-being concerns. Potential complications may include:

Jaw pain and discomfort

TMJ disorders

Tooth grinding or clenching (bruxism)

Difficulty maintaining oral hygiene

Risk of tooth decay and gum disease

Speech difficulties

Negative impact on self-confidence

Braces and Invisalign Clear Aligners

Braces are an effective solution for correcting overbites by gradually realigning teeth and improving jaw positioning. In more severe cases, treatment may involve tooth extractions or the use of additional orthodontic appliances to achieve optimal results. For mild to moderate cases, clear aligners provide a discreet and convenient alternative, allowing for easy maintenance while delivering effective outcomes.

Surgical Intervention

Severe overbites resulting from jaw irregularities might necessitate surgical intervention. This procedure realigns the jaw to improve function and aesthetics and is typically combined with orthodontic care for optimal outcomes. The recovery process usually involves a short hospital stay followed by several weeks of rest to allow for proper healing and adjustment.

Prevention and Early Intervention Strategies

Early intervention is essential for preventing severe overbites and overjets. The American Association of Orthodontists advises that children see an orthodontist by the age of 7 to detect and address any emerging concerns early on. Moreover, correcting childhood habits such as thumb-sucking or tongue-thrusting can significantly help in reducing the risk of these conditions.

FAQ

Is it OK to have an overbite?

A mild overbite is generally normal and may not need treatment, as some vertical overlap of the upper and lower teeth is part of natural dental alignment. However, if the overbite is severe, such that the lower teeth are significantly obscured or there are related complications like jaw discomfort or difficulty chewing, it’s important to consult an orthodontist for a detailed evaluation and personalized treatment plan.

What causes an overbite?

Overbites may develop due to various causes, including inherited traits, early childhood habits like thumb-sucking or prolonged pacifier use, speech issues, and extra teeth. These factors can influence jaw development and contribute to the formation of an overbite.

How can an overbite be corrected?

Overbites can be corrected using various methods based on the severity of the condition. Orthodontic treatments like braces, clear aligners, rubber bands, or bite pads work progressively to realign the teeth and improve the bite. For severe cases, surgical procedures may be necessary to reposition the jaw and achieve the best possible results.
